LQ4 Swap, Performance Online or Stock Mounts

I am finally getting around to putting an LQ4 into my 68. I have the motor in using the stock 6 cyl perches and motor mounts. I like that it sits way back in the engine compartment, but dont like the stock mounts with the center hole in the mount.

Can i use the peformance online pedestals and keep the motor in the same location or will using them mean i have to move the motor forward to the sbc location?

Re: LQ4 Swap, Performance Online or Stock Mounts

The POL mounts can put them in the forward or rearward mounting points, whichever you need. I tried stock mounts and after many swear words, I got them installed. However nothing would fit for exhaust manifolds, I tried stock truck, fbody and I also tried Sanderson shorties. When I put the POL mounts on it moved the motor up about 1" or so which made room for my Sanderson headers. I put them as far back as I could since I wanted dual electric fans with the stock radiator.

ECE I believe stradles both and puts the motor right in the middle of the mount holes.
